Ver Mensaje Individual
  #1 (permalink)  
Antiguo 08/01/2011, 00:13
helsingius
 
Fecha de Ingreso: diciembre-2008
Mensajes: 52
Antigüedad: 15 años, 4 meses
Puntos: 0
Como se debe utilizar esta funcion

Hola que tal Colegas de Foros Web

Aqui tengo un problema


Segun Yo uso esta consulta para que no se repitan los registros


$sql="SELECT DISTINCT (Nombre,Apellido,Direccion,Ciudad) FROM tabla";


Lo que quiero es que no haga esto


Nombre Apellido Calle Ciudad
1.- dato1 dato2 dato3 dato4
2.- dato1 dato2 dato3 dato4


como pueden ver quiero que si los 4 campos coiciden que es

Nombre
Apellido
Calle
Ciudad

no se registre el dato

Pero si cambia un dato si se registre ejemplo


Nombre Apellido Calle Ciudad
1.- dato1 dato2 dato3 dato4
2.- doble1 dato2 dato3 dato4



se fijan en la palabra cambio doble1 es decir que las filas son parecidas pero no iguales.

Ya puse como valor primario y autonumerico el id que es

1.-
2.-

Tambien pueden registrarse archivos asi

Nombre Apellido Calle Ciudad
1.- dato1 dato2 dato3 dato4
2.- dato1 doble2 dato3 dato4


Si se fijan aqui cambio el apellido doble2 osea que es parecida pero no igual.

Como lo hago ya me aburri arto buscar esta solucion llevo como 3 dias buscando la solucion y por eso escribo aqui.